scully931 said:
Yes. The same thing happened to me. I live in a city and tried three different post offices. Finally one knew what I was talking about, but was out of them and didn't know how to use them. :crazy:

It seems to me buying European stamps online may actually be easier than buying the IRC in our own country.

But you have to know what the airmail postage is to the country you live in. I got a friend to send me US stamps for my SASE but she sent me normal 1st class stamps. I had to check with three other people before I was able to confirm that this would NOT be enough and find out the correct amount - I had to get more stamps to make up the 84 cents postage.

Postage from the UK to the US is I think 72 pence - but I wouldn't likke to swear that and I can't find out for you now as I'm not in Britain. It's seventy-something.
